freeware Free software is a matter of freedom not of price. So says the Free Software Foundation (FSF). Open Source Software although mostly free is slightly different. The term “open source” software is used by some people to mean more or less the same category as free software.

On 25 August, Sony announced the third member of its new Reader family – the Reader Daily Edition™ and a new library content service. The Reader Daily Edition has a seven-inch touch screen with 16 levels of gray as well as a AT&T 3G modem, enabling it to pull content wirelessly. It'll launch in December for $400. Along side that Google as made available more than a million eBooks for the Sony eBook reader.
